Core Viewpoint - The event "Yunhe Pear Garden Night: Light and Shadow Reflecting Ten Thousand Homes" aims to promote traditional Chinese culture through a series of activities, including a Peking opera film tour along the Grand Canal, engaging students in appreciating the charm of traditional arts and the essence of Chinese culture [1] Group 1: Event Overview - The event took place at Tianjin No. 1 Middle School, providing a platform for nearly a hundred students to experience the allure of Peking opera and understand the depth of Chinese traditional culture [1] - The Peking opera film tour coincides with the 120th anniversary of Chinese cinema and the full connectivity of the Grand Canal, highlighting the cultural significance of Peking opera films [1] Group 2: Educational Impact - Director Liu Xuezhong emphasized that Peking opera films convey the core values of loyalty, filial piety, and righteousness inherent in Chinese traditional culture, offering students new perspectives on life [2] - The integration of storytelling and narrative in teaching is seen as a viable approach to reforming ideological and political education, with Peking opera serving as a rich source of historical narratives [3] Group 3: Cultural Engagement - Tianjin Peking Opera actors engaged with students, allowing them to experience the fundamental skills of Peking opera, fostering a deeper understanding of the art form beyond theoretical knowledge [4] - The combination of film and traditional opera is viewed as a means to enrich campus cultural life and enhance ideological education, promoting a seamless integration of cultural appreciation and educational values [6][7]
